在旅行规划中,选择合适的酒店入住日期是确保旅行顺利的关键一步。尤其是在旅游高峰期,酒店价格往往会飙升,而且很难找到理想的住宿。今天,我们就来聊聊如何利用jQuery来帮助我们轻松选择酒店入住日期,避免高峰期的陷阱。
了解酒店入住日期的重要性
首先,让我们明确为什么选择合适的酒店入住日期如此重要。以下是一些关键点:
- 价格因素:高峰期酒店价格通常比平时高很多。
- 房间可用性:高峰期酒店房间紧张,可能难以找到心仪的房型。
- 服务质量:高峰期酒店服务人员可能会因为工作量过大而服务质量下降。
使用jQuery优化酒店入住日期选择
为了帮助用户轻松选择酒店入住日期,我们可以利用jQuery编写一个简单的插件。以下是一个基本的实现步骤:
1. 创建HTML结构
首先,我们需要一个HTML结构来展示酒店入住日期的选择:
<div id="hotel-check-in">
<label for="check-in-date">入住日期:</label>
<input type="text" id="check-in-date" placeholder="选择日期">
<button id="check-in-btn">检查可用性</button>
</div>
2. 编写jQuery脚本
接下来,我们编写jQuery脚本,用于处理日期选择和可用性检查:
$(document).ready(function() {
$('#check-in-btn').click(function() {
var checkInDate = $('#check-in-date').val();
if (checkInDate) {
// 调用API检查日期可用性
checkAvailability(checkInDate);
} else {
alert('请选择入住日期!');
}
});
function checkAvailability(date) {
// 这里应该是调用后端API的代码,以下为示例
$.ajax({
url: 'https://api.hotel.com/availability',
type: 'GET',
data: { date: date },
success: function(response) {
if (response.available) {
alert('恭喜,您选择的日期有可用房间!');
} else {
alert('抱歉,您选择的日期没有可用房间。');
}
},
error: function() {
alert('检查日期可用性失败,请稍后再试!');
}
});
}
});
3. 测试和优化
完成以上步骤后,我们需要测试插件以确保其功能正常。在测试过程中,可以根据用户反馈进行优化。
避免高峰期陷阱的额外建议
除了使用jQuery插件,以下是一些额外的建议,帮助您避免高峰期陷阱:
- 提前预订:提前预订可以享受更优惠的价格,并确保有房可住。
- 关注酒店优惠:关注酒店官网或第三方预订平台上的优惠活动。
- 灵活选择日期:如果可能,尽量选择非高峰期的日期入住。
通过以上方法,您就可以利用jQuery轻松选择酒店入住日期,避免高峰期的陷阱,享受一次愉快的旅行。
